The Heterogeneity of Composition and Microstructure in Cast Large Sized 3104 Alloy Slab
Abstract:
Heterogeneity of composition and microstructure in cast large sized 3104 aluminium alloy slab were studied using AES-ICP, OM, SEM, etc. The results show that the cooling rate on the cross section of 3104 slab is different, macro-segregation is found in the different section in the slab .The content of Ti decreases gradually from the surface to about 1/4 thickness of the slab, then increases rapidly to the center of slab; other elements content increases gradually from the surface to the about 1/4 thickness and then decreases rapidly to the center; the grain size on the surface area is fine, and the grain size at the center is coarse , segregation of Mg is found within the grains; great amount compound is found to be of presence on the grain boundary, with chemical compositions of Al 87(FeMn)13 and Al83(FeMn)12Si5; The compound size at the surface area is comparatively smaller, and coarser at the centre of slab.
